131

Custom Rom / rooting Options vor TB-125FU (Lenovo Tab M10 Plus 3rd Gen)

 1 year ago
source link: https://forum.xda-developers.com/t/custom-rom-rooting-options-vor-tb-125fu-lenovo-tab-m10-plus-3rd-gen.4480023/page-6#post-88337647
Go to the source link to view the article. You can view the picture content, updated content and better typesetting reading experience. If the link is broken, please click the button below to view the snapshot at that time.
neoserver,ios ssh client

Custom Rom / rooting Options vor TB-125FU (Lenovo Tab M10 Plus 3rd Gen)

@joeblowma

hi

nice. you have solved the Problem.
when i have time, can you write a short manual?

-----

well, i have used Universal Android Debloater GUI today.

thats a good tool i think. i have uninstall many apps such youtube, kids, google file and photos and lenovo tablet center

has someone else xp with that?

i cant find the com.google.android.apps.XXX

for

- gmail
- google PlayStore (not recommended)
- google Assist
- Memo (lenovo i think)
- GBoard (i have no idea. its for digital key board, when i deactivate, only speechassist work)
- Google-Service
- SMART Launcher (whats that?)
You can install a lot of those from APKmirror. GBoard is the keyboard. If you don't want to reinstall it, check to see in the language/input settings to see if there's another soft/virtual keyboard to set as default.
Smart Launcher is the default home launcher. If you uninstalled that, you'll have to adb push and install another launcher apk.

fire_cuber

Member
Dec 28, 2020
Hey everyone.
i reading all your posts, but i cant imagine bring my tablet to a root. i have a different firmware like rescue image. What can i do? Can everone tell my step by step?

Please

My Firmware Version on Tablet
TB125FU_S000118_220927_ROW
The Download
TB125FU_S000139_221208_ROW


@joeblowma
You have the boot.img from 220927? Can you give it to me?
can it work with tah t for me?

thx
have a nice week
Do you still have the download TB125FU_S000139_221208_ROW?
I need the boot.img of it please.

I am currently on TB125FU_S000139_221208.

I wanted to do the OTA update to TB125FU_S000144_230105_ROW today but Magisk says.
stock backup does not exist.
I know how to fix this but I need the boot.img from the TB125FU_S000139_221208_ROW
gist.github.com

fix-magisk-stock-backup-does-not-exist.md

GitHub Gist: instantly share code, notes, and snippets.
gist.github.com

Reactions: art99

joeblowma

Senior Member
Oct 26, 2012 Edmonton
Do you still have the download TB125FU_S000139_221208_ROW?
I need the boot.img of it please.

Here you go, let me know if it works out for you. I just did this second update to 144 and nothing except a factory reset worked. This time, I couldn't even get magisk to recognize the clean copy following instructions that worked before, the instructions you just mentioned, and the shell script talked about in the comments there... weird all around.

Attachments

  • TB125FU_S000139_221208_ROW_boot.zip
    20.3 MB · Views: 15

fire_cuber

Member
Dec 28, 2020
Here you go, let me know if it works out for you. I just did this second update to 144 and nothing except a factory reset worked. This time, I couldn't even get magisk to recognize the clean copy following instructions that worked before, the instructions you just mentioned, and the shell script talked about in the comments there... weird all around.

Thank you very much, I will test it.

I ended up RMA-ing the tablet. Couldn't find any other solution to fixing it, so that was the end result. :/

Reactions: joeblowma

fire_cuber

Member
Dec 28, 2020
Here you go, let me know if it works out for you. I just did this second update to 144 and nothing except a factory reset worked. This time, I couldn't even get magisk to recognize the clean copy following instructions that worked before, the instructions you just mentioned, and the shell script talked about in the comments there... weird all around.
Yes, it's a pity that it didn't work for me either, so I'll reset the whole thing.
But thanks anyway for the file.

[Edit]
Hmm, resetting with the "Rescue and Smart Assistant" tool from Lenovo doesn't work either.
But the tablet still starts as it is with root+magisk.
I will now leave the tablet as it is and not install any further updates.
I don't feel like doing any more tests.
Last edited: Feb 19, 2023

Reactions: joeblowma

joeblowma

Senior Member
Oct 26, 2012 Edmonton
Hmm, resetting with the "Rescue and Smart Assistant" tool from Lenovo doesn't work either.

We discussed copiously how broken their "smart" assistant is. They seem to have prioritized security, oddly as we can root it fairly easily, over end users being able to restore software problems.

I have no idea why the process of having root even after reflashing the unmodified bootloader doesn't let updating work without a factory reset, but with Swift Backup I'm able to use root to backup around 95% of everything, put the clean bootloader, factory reset, update, root again and restore nearly everything in around an hour (mostly spent waiting).

After doing it twice inside a month or so... I'm almost at the point of trying some GSI ROMs instead.

We discussed copiously how broken their "smart" assistant is. They seem to have prioritized security, oddly as we can root it fairly easily, over end users being able to restore software problems.

I have no idea why the process of having root even after reflashing the unmodified bootloader doesn't let updating work without a factory reset, but with Swift Backup I'm able to use root to backup around 95% of everything, put the clean bootloader, factory reset, update, root again and restore nearly everything in around an hour (mostly spent waiting).

After doing it twice inside a month or so... I'm almost at the point of trying some GSI ROMs instead.
Let us know if you succeed in that venture. I'd love to ditch Lenovo's software as well.

HansDampfi

Member
Jan 24, 2023
I am very satisfied with the tablet and its quality. It's a pity that there aren't that many and that the incentive to push CFW is so low
Hey i got one of these tablets ( a TB125FU) how do i go with installing a custom rom on it ive rooted it with magisk already but now i want to put a gsi on it or something
Hey i got one of these tablets ( a TB125FU) how do i go with installing a custom rom on it ive rooted it with magisk already but now i want to put a gsi on it or something

Ive tried putting one on in the past and it just bootloops

ms32035

New member
Mar 27, 2023
Did anyone succeed with a custom ROM in the end? I just upgraded to TB125FU_S000160_230227_ROW via RSA, end despite removing userdata flash and format from FlashInfo.tmp after the upgrade the only thing that worked was a factory reset. This is the second time it happened to me. Thinking about selling this tablet if that's how every upgrade will look like.

Top Liked Posts

  • For sure, it would be nice to kill that serial port notification on mine too.

    It's pretty simple, definetly a very annoying message...go to settings, apps, see all apps, click the 3 dot menu at top right, show system, go to android system, notifications, turn off developer messages

    Hmm, resetting with the "Rescue and Smart Assistant" tool from Lenovo doesn't work either.

    We discussed copiously how broken their "smart" assistant is. They seem to have prioritized security, oddly as we can root it fairly easily, over end users being able to restore software problems.

    I have no idea why the process of having root even after reflashing the unmodified bootloader doesn't let updating work without a factory reset, but with Swift Backup I'm able to use root to backup around 95% of everything, put the clean bootloader, factory reset, update, root again and restore nearly everything in around an hour (mostly spent waiting).

    After doing it twice inside a month or so... I'm almost at the point of trying some GSI ROMs instead.

    ok, so ur just pulling the boot img from one of the GSI roms...im just trying to pull the stock boot img...do you happen to know where one can download the stock firmware for this device, this is my 1st lenovo tablet

    LMSA. https://pcsupport.lenovo.com/us/en/downloads/ds101291-rescue-and-smart-assistant-lmsa
    Use this tool. Install and explore the file and folder structure it creates. Interrupt the process before it flashes your tablet for it will erase the files you need from your computer if you don't. Use trial and error here.

    Since the original question was about root, Ill keep this going

    I was able to download the most recent ROM from Lenovo rescue which was super simple, it downloads the ROM first and wont start the flash till you click the button. I did retrieve the stock boot.img, patched it, and flashed it, rebooted and had root. Heres where the many hours of fun started...I realized my wifi wasnt working (good sign something was messed up during flash). I realize the ROM downloaded from the Lenovo Rescue was newer then my old ROM. So I had flashed the newer boot.img over the old ROM (not good). I went back to Lenovo rescue to actually make use of the rescue and flash a full ROM. After completion I became stuck in fastboot mode. I could boot to recovery but not system and every restart or shutdown and restart would go straight to fastboot.

    I did try to manually flash the ROM using what i thought was the right files and order (using flashinfo.txt as the order and MT6768_Android_scatter.txt for the partition names for each image). Everything flashed successfully, but upon reboot I was still stuck in fastboot mode. I tried everything I could think of and even ran the Lenovo Rescue a few times.

    After many hours, I came across this command for fastboot..."fastboot set_active a" which finally allowed me to boot into system. I assume this tablet uses the A/B slot partitions, but I think they only make use of the A for boot? Thats my thought

    So next is too try to patch the correct disc.img for my current rom (which is the latest from Lenovo Rescue) and flash again making sure to flash to the boot_a partition and hopefully everything goes like it should

    Hopefully that command helps someone save many hours if they find themselves stuck in fastboot mode while rooting and/or flashing.
    I am very satisfied with the tablet and its quality. It's a pity that there aren't that many and that the incentive to push CFW is so low

About Joyk


Aggregate valuable and interesting links.
Joyk means Joy of geeK